[ARCHIVED] Summer Reading Programs begin June 9th

Summer is coming and with it comes the fun of the 2014 Summer Reading Club at the Rockwall County Library. The theme this year is “Fizz, Boom, Read!” Children of all ages are encouraged to read about science of all sorts as well as inventions, engineering marvels, and the future of technology. In addition to reading books, children are invited to listen to stories, enjoy programs of puppets, movies, magic, and crafts, and participate in other great events. All Summer Reading Club programs are FREE at the Rockwall County Library. Come join the fun!

WHO: Children ages 2 years through 12 years may register for the reading club.
WHEN: Summer Reading Club registration begins Monday, June 9, 2014,at 10:00 a.m. and
continues through July 26. The Summer Reading Club ends on Saturday, August 9, 2014.
WHERE: All events will be heldat the Rockwall County Library, 1215 E. Yellowjacket Lane.
KICK-OFF EVENT: Start your summer fun at our “Library Laboratory” kick-off event on
Monday, June 9th. Come and go between1:30 p.m. and 3:30 p.m. for a good time of crafts, science experiments, and refreshments. You can also register for the Summer Reading Club at
the event. Summer reading programs for adults, teens and babies are also available!
